Decanted and let sit for two hours, with just a quick taste at pop and pour. Delicious.

I’ve been staring at these bottles for quite some time, and while it’s still very early, I feel like I got a pretty good preview of what this has in store. The youth is compressing the fruit on the nose, allowing the oak, earth, flint, spice, and dried flowers to take center stage.

There’s a touch of iodine on the initial palate, followed by increasingly complex fruit. Blue, black, and red fruits all emerged more and more as the night progressed, but they were never really at the fore. Everything feels beautifully integrated, layered, and just a little restrained right now.

Lovely wine, but I’m putting a sticky note on the remaining bottles: do not touch for five years.

Got it on recommendation from a buddy who just drank 150 wines on a trip to Napa and said this was his favorite.
Blackberry, cherry, chocolate and tobacco. Grippy tannins, nice acidity to bring it together. Well balanced and drinking beautifully.
